How can we live out Jesus' vision for our cities amidst the complexities of modern life? In this teaching, Tyler Staton offers us a compelling vision for loving our neighbors and communities, both acknowledging the obstacles we must overcome in living that vision and challenging us to reorient our values and priorities around the Kingdom of God rather than our broader culture.
Key Scripture Passage: Romans 12v2-3
